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Dayton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Dayton?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Dayton is at University Station listed at $780.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Dayton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Dayton is $1,913.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Dayton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Dayton is a 2,529 square feet unit starting from $3,584 at 1354 Broadway.

What is the average size for Dayton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Dayton is currently at 870 sq ft.
